Welcome to GTPlanet, yanogore: You can only get the optimum racing line when driving the license tests, and by pressing R3 at any time. You can toggle it on and off (blue for acceleration, red for braking, white for off-throttle).
It does not work in the races, you just have to learn them yourself. Previous GT games had a darker racing line (it's clearest in GT2, in my opinion), as well as in the original GT and GT3. But for in GT4, Polyphony Digital introduced a "more-or-less" real-life racing line, since there are also tire marks showing how to run off the track. It's not always accurate for every car, and skid marks are sometimes placed to fool you more than help you.
Your best bet is to practice the license tests and practice, practice, practice... GT1 through GT3 had manuals going over the basics of car control and racing lines, but GT4 sort of short-changed the buyer.
